Abstract
The thermal and photochemical decomposition of methyl benzoate (p-tolylsulfonyl) hydrazone salts in 1, 2-dimethoxyethane, 1, 2-diethoxyethane, or diglyme gives rise to benzaldehyde dimethyl acetal, methyl benzoate azine (II), meso-1, 2-diphenyl-1, 2- dimethoxyethane, and methyl α-(p-tolylsulfonyl) benzyl ether.
